Polymer Capital Management is a market-neutral, multi-manager investment platform based in Asia and US, with a primary focus in Asia markets. Polymer combines established institutional support and deep knowledge of local financial markets with a dedication to discovering and developing the region's best investment talent. Polymer was established in conjunction with PAG, one of the world's largest Asia-focused alternative asset managers, in 2019.

Role Overview

The Associate, Human Capital will support day‑to‑day HR operations for the New York office, with a primary focus on payroll processing, HR administration, and employee lifecycle activities (onboarding and offboarding). This is a hands‑on role suited to a collaborative team player who is comfortable working in a fast‑paced financial services environment and partnering closely with HR, Finance, and business leaders.

Key Responsibilities

  • Process end‑to‑end payroll for employees, ensuring tax compliance and timely funding
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state and local wage and hour laws, payroll tax regulations, and applicable employment regulations for New York (and any other US states where employees sit).
  • Act as day‑to‑day point of contact with ADP and other HR/payroll vendors, troubleshooting issues and driving process improvements.
  • Manage US work visa processes for new hires and employees by coordinating documentation, and internal approvals in partnership with external immigration counsel.
  • Partner with hiring managers and the Human Capital team to support end‑to‑end recruitment for US roles, including scheduling interviews, coordinating candidate communication and managing the ATS system
  •  Prepare offer letters and related documentation, conduct reference calls, collection of required personal and compliance information, and alignment with internal approval workflows.
  • Support employee onboarding: set up new hires in HRIS and ADP, coordinate background checks, and run Day 1 orientation logistics.
  • Support employee offboarding: process terminations in systems, calculate and process final pay in line with New York requirements, coordinate notice letters, benefits cessation and access removal.
  • Respond to employee queries on pay, benefits, policies and HR processes with a high level of discretion and service orientation.
  • Partner with the broader Human Capital team in Asia to ensure consistency of policies, while adapting for US and New York‑specific regulatory requirements.

Requirements
  • 3–5 years of HR operations, payroll or HR generalist experience, ideally in financial services or a fast‑paced professional services environment.
  • Strong, hands‑on experience with ADP payroll (similar platforms), including multi‑state payroll and bonus compensation structures.
  • Solid understanding of US payroll tax regulations, New York employment laws and; exposure to benefits compliance (COBRA, ERISA) is preferred.
  •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Business, Finance or related field preferred; relevant payroll or HR certifications are an advantage but not mandatory

Competencies and Personal Attributes

  • Highly detail‑oriented with strong numerical and analytical skills, able to manage confidential data with discretion.
  • Hands‑on, proactive approach to operations, willing to dive into the details while maintaining a process‑improvement mindset.
  • Collaborative team player with strong communication skills and a client‑service focus toward both employees and internal stakeholders.

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ene

As the undisputed financial capital of the world, New York City is an epicenter of startup funding activity. The city has a thriving fintech scene and is a major player in verticals ranging from AI to biotech, cybersecurity and digital media. It also has universities like NYU, Columbia and Cornell Tech attracting students and researchers from across the globe, providing the ecosystem with a constant influx of world-class talent. And its East Coast location and three international airports make it a perfect spot for European companies establishing a foothold in the United States.

Key Facts About NYC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
  •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
